The Age Discrimination Act
*
*
* *
The 2006 Employment Equality Regulations Act came into force on 1 October 2006 making it unlawful to discriminate against workers, employees, job seekers and trainees because of their age.

*
 
* *

If you are advertising for a "junior designer" or someone with "at least 10 years experience" or even if you describe your business as "young and energetic" you are breaking the law.

The DBA lawyers, Humphries Kirk, have put together a synopsis of the Act and its implications for your business.
